THE UK R2-D2 Builders Club will be coming to Cumbria as part of this year’s Windermere Science Festival.

Their droids appeared in the latest Star Wars films. 

Accompanying club engineer Mark Leigh will be replicas of R2-D2 and Chewbacca – robots that are built to be as close as can be to the films’ originals.

The R2-D2 Builders Club is an international community that builds its own robots from the Star Wars universe.

Visitors will be able to interact with the replicas and hear about the measuring, cutting, painting and electronics behind the droids’ operation.

The festival’s director Nick Greenall said: “We’re thrilled that two of the biggest stars to have ever graced our screens have decided to visit Windermere. The club’s droids have featured at major Disney events and can be seen in the latest Star Wars films. So to have them come to Cumbria is truly exciting.”

The R2-D2 Builders Club will be at the Windermere Jetty Museum on May 13/14.
